CorePower Yoga and Venus Williams Serve Up Chic Activewear

John Dody
11/14/23 5:01PM

CorePower Yoga, a leader in the yoga studio space, has teamed up with EleVen by Venus Williams to launch a groundbreaking line of activewear. This collaboration is a seamless blend of yoga’s flexibility and the athletic prowess of tennis, brought to life by the tennis icon herself, Venus Williams.

🌈 Fashion Meets Function: The exclusive collection is a harmony of seasonal color palettes, elegant designs, and high-performance materials. Designed with an ultra-soft, luxe compressive fabric, the activewear promises to offer a ‘second-skin’ feel, ensuring wearers experience both top-notch performance and unparalleled comfort during their yoga sessions.

🎾 Venus Williams’ Vision: EleVen by Venus Williams, birthed from the tennis champion’s flair for fashion and active lifestyle, brings tennis court-inspired styles to the yoga mat for the first time. The brand’s ethos of confidence, power, and capability is vividly reflected in each piece, empowering wearers to embrace their best selves.

🍂 A Collection for All Yogis: The collection, featuring rich fall and winter colorways, is meticulously crafted to cater to yoga students of all levels. From beginners to seasoned practitioners, each item is designed to enhance the yoga experience, mirroring EleVen’s signature style and philosophy.

🧘‍♀️ CorePower Yoga’s Holistic Approach: Founded in 2002 in Denver, CorePower Yoga focuses on making the transformative benefits of yoga accessible through a fitness-centric approach. This partnership with EleVen aligns perfectly with CorePower’s ethos of personal growth, empowerment, and holistic wellness.
